Examine This Report on what is md5 technology

Preimage assaults. MD5 is liable to preimage attacks, exactly where an attacker can find an enter that hashes to a certain benefit. This power to reverse-engineer a hash weakens MD5’s effectiveness in guarding sensitive data.

Principal Compression Operate: Each and every block in the message goes through a compression function that updates the point out variables dependant on the block information plus the past condition. This requires a number of logical and arithmetic functions, which include bitwise functions and modular addition.

One of many major takes advantage of of MD5 is in information integrity checks. Whenever you obtain a file from the online world, How are you going to be particular It really is the same as the initial and has not been tampered with? This is when our trusty MD5 will come into Participate in. The first file is processed through the MD5 algorithm to provide a unique hash.

The LUHN formula was made from the late nineteen sixties by a group of mathematicians. Soon thereafter, charge card firms

Insufficient Salting: MD5 lacks the idea of salting (adding random data into the enter ahead of hashing), that's vital for enhancing password storage security and various apps. MD5 hashes are more at risk of rainbow desk assaults with no salting.

A hash collision happens when two diverse inputs generate a similar hash benefit, or output. The safety and encryption of the hash algorithm count on building unique hash values, and collisions represent security vulnerabilities that may be exploited.

Just about every block is processed in a very 4-round loop that employs a collection of constants obtained from the sine functionality to conduct unique bitwise functions and nonlinear functions.

Extra a short while ago, InfoSecurity Journal described very last 12 months that the information belonging to 817,000 RuneScape subscribers to bot supplier EpicBot was uploaded to the identical hacking discussion boards from a previous breach at the business.

This algorithm is regarded as being the quicker parametric line-clipping algorithm. The subsequent ideas are used With this clipping: The parametric equation of the line

MD5 has long been greatly made use of for quite some time as a consequence of quite a few noteworthy strengths, notably in situations in which speed and simplicity are important concerns. They include:

Checksum era. MD5 is used to produce checksums for information blocks or files. These checksums are often Employed in software package distribution, wherever builders supply an MD5 hash so consumers can verify the downloaded file is complete and unaltered.

Preimage Assaults: MD5 is check here vulnerable to preimage attacks, where an attacker tries to discover an input that matches a selected hash benefit.

An additional weak point is pre-image and 2nd pre-impression resistance. What does this mean? Properly, Preferably, it should be unachievable to create the first input knowledge from its MD5 hash or to find a distinct enter Using the very same hash.

In order to delve into each and every phase of how MD5 turns an input into a set 128-bit hash, head in excess of to our The MD5 algorithm (with examples) short article.

Leave a Reply

Your email address will not be published. Required fields are marked *